Evaluation of trace elements in essential thrombocytosis and reactive thrombocytosis

Özet (EN)

Introduction: Essential thrombocytosis (ET), is a clonal stem cell disorder and one of the chronic myeloproliferative neoplasm characterized by a significant increase in the platelet levels. The present study aimed to investigate the role of trace elements in acquired clonal thrombocytosis and the role of this disorder on the levels of trace elements. Patients were evaluated with reactive thrombocytosis based on the levels of trace elements on healthy group. Material and Methods: Individuals were categorized as patients with ET diagnosis (Group1-n=30), patients with reactive thrombocytosis secondary to iron deficiency anemia (Group 2- n=30) and healthy controls (Group 3-n=30). Aluminum (Al), copper (Cu), boron (B), zinc (Zn), iron (Fe), chromium (Cr), cobalt (Co), magnesium (Mg), manganese ( Mn), nickel (Ni), selenium (Se), silicon (Si) levels were analyzed by ICP-OES instrument. Results: The comparision between three groups for trace elements showed that Al (p<0,001), Zn (p=0,02), Fe (p<0,001), Co (p=0,01), Mg (p=0,01), Mn (p<0,001), Ni (p<0,001), Se (p<0,001), Si (p<0,001) were significant. Mg (p=0,02), Mn (p<0,001), Ni (p<0,001), Co (p=0,04) were notably higher and Si (p=0,04) were notably lower in group-1 than group-2. Mn (p=0,02), Ni (p=0,001) Co (p=0,02) were significantly higher and Se (p<0,001), Si (p<0,001), Al (p<0,001) were significantly lower in group-1 than group-3. Additionally, Se (p<0,001), Mg (p=0,009), Fe (p<0,001), Al (p<0,001), Zn (p=0,02) were notably lower group-2 than group-3. Follow up time in ET was corelated significantly for Ni (p=0,023; r = 0,41) and Si (p=0,04; r=-0,36). Conclusion: This study with higher levels and lower levels of trace elements (Se, Si, Al, Mg, Mn, Ni, Zn, Co, Fe) showed that essential elements may be rolled in mechanisms of causes or complications on ET. Further spesific studies about this topic will provide valuable contributions to the understanding of the ethiopathogenesis and prognosis on ET.
